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Podcast Production & Management -- You produce and manage Luma Health's podcast properties, currently Unjargoned and DHOA (Digital Health on Air). These are pipeline assets, not vanity projects. Every episode should serve the demand engine.
  • Own end-to-end podcast production: guest coordination, pre-interview prep, remote recording (Riverside or similar), editing, mixing, and publishing.
  • Develop episode concepts aligned with the editorial direction set by the Director, focusing on pipeline blockers, customer outcomes, and the AI platform story.
  • Edit episodes for pacing, clarity, and storytelling. Produce polished audio that reflects a professional brand, not a side project.
  • Create derivative assets from each episode: audiograms, pull quotes, short-form clips, and written summaries that fuel social, email, and ABM.
  • Manage the publishing calendar, show notes, and distribution across podcast platforms.
  • Track listener engagement and identify which episodes and topics drive downstream pipeline activity.
  • Customer Story & Case Study Video -- Customer proof is one of the highest-leverage assets the demand team has. You turn real customer outcomes into compelling video content that sales, ABM, and marketing can use across the funnel.
  • Own the full production lifecycle: identifying the right customer stories (with Sales, CS, Content, and the Director), coordinating interviews, recording, editing, and delivering final assets.
  • Conduct remote video interviews with customers and executives using tools like Riverside or Zoom, making non-professional talent feel comfortable and drawing out authentic, specific stories.
